[quote]I'd like to create a template to use the fckEditor to input data onto a page. When I tried putting an [@cms.editBar /] into a template it gave me a parse error saying cms.editBar was not found. I was hoping I could find an example[/quote]
In Magnolia 4.5, an editable component gets an edit bar automatically. All you need to do is render an area. The area will iterate through its components, rendering them one-by-one. There is a simple example in the Introduction to templating tutorial. Change the 'edit' control to 'fckEdit' in the component's dialog definition. http://documentation.magnolia-cms.com/templates/introduction.html The CMS tag library where cms.editBar comes from was dropped in Magnolia 4.5. The functions of the old library are replaced by the new cmsfn and stkfn templating functions. But as stated above, you likely won't need the editBar tag since it gets injected automatically.
